Confitería La Ideal

  • Address: Suipacha 384, at Av. Corrientes, El Centro, Buenos Aires, Buenos Aires
  • Phone: 11/4326-0521

Fodor's Review:

Part of the charm of this spacious 1918 coffeeshop-milonga is its sense of nostalgia: think fleur-de-lis motifs, time-worn European furnishings, and stained glass. No wonder they chose to film the 1998 movie The Tango Lesson here. La Ideal is famous for its palmeritas (glazed cookies) and tea service. Tango lessons are offered Monday through Thursday from noon to 3, with a full-blown tango ball Wednesday and Saturday from 3 to 8. The waitstaff seem to be caught up in their own dreams -- service is listless.

  • Credit Cards: No credit cards
  • Closed: No breakfast weekends
  • Metro: C to C. Pellegrini, D to 9 de Julio
